Emerald Glen Eviction Risk: Lower

2 census tracts · pop 11,054 · pop-weighted Eviction Risk Score 2.5/10 · range 2.4–2.5

Emerald Glen is a white (non-hispanic) neighborhood in Loveland with 2 census tracts and a population of 11,054 residents. The neighborhood's pop-weighted eviction-risk score of 2.5/10 (Lower tier) blends state law, county-level fil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income ratios + poverty. 46% of renters here pay at least 30% of household income on rent, and 16% are severely cost-burdened (≥50% of income). Average gross rent of $1,947/month sits 13% higher than the Loveland citywide average ($1,730).
